Job Description

Overview

We are looking for an experienced Junior Indirect Tax Leader to join our team to help in maintaining and enhancing the best one-stop indirect tax solution for all small businesses worldwide. We need you to help us build up our global, cloud-based Automated Sales Tax platform for QuickBooks Online. This role will challenge you to marry your knowledge of the complex array of global, state, and local indirect tax regulations with the needs of our small business customers. This will enable simple, guiding, and delightful user experiences, targeted to small business owners across the US and Internationally. Your tax research and analysis skills, as well as acute attention to detail, will be needed as we maintain the existing, as well as develop new, sales and use tax rates and compliance rules across the globe.

What you'll bring

  • Strong analytical skills with ability to identify problems and solutions with use of market or internal data
  • Sound understanding of U.S. and International direct and indirect tax
  • Excellent research, analysis, and writing skills with the ability to read, understand, and interpret transaction tax-related information, publications, and documents accurately, efficiently, and effectively, as well as an ability to communicate all issues simply
  • Demonstrated contributions to a broad cross-functional work environment
  • Juris Doctorate (J.D.) with 2-3 years experience in Sales and Use Tax operations in a service-related technology business or CPA with 6 or more years experience in Sales and Use Tax operations in a service-related technology business
  • Strong ability to attend to projects, acute attention to detail, follow-up and follow-through skills, and positive attitude
  • Ability to think end-to-end about how to meet customer needs in a way that is operationally sustainable
  • Self-starter who can operate independently or within a team and balance multiple priorities and objectives

How you will lead

  • Communicate and develop relationships with various Tax Authorities to research and solve specific complex tax issues
  • Plan for effective processes to proactively maintain all research data inside the Automated Sales Tax system
  • Work with a cross functional team (Dev, QA, XD, Operations, Regulatory Affairs, Sales Tax Compliance, Subscriber Communications, Marketing, Customer Care) for successful releases
  • Understand and define the end-to-end customer experience and service delivery process for Automated Sales Tax features
  • Serve as a resource to anyone within Intuit for tax issue explanation, research, and/or resolution
  • Research, monitor, and accurately interpret Country, State, and Local laws, rules, and regulations pertaining to Sales, Use, GST, and Value Added Taxes
  • Address a variety of indirect tax issues as needed and be able to communicate findings clearly, concisely, and without error internally and externally
  • Participate in internal and external indirect tax groups, including presentations, as requested by manager or director, representing Intuit, Inc.
  • Work closely with the Technology Development team to update the Automated Sales Tax engine monthly due to taxability and rate changes
